Not to completely denounce the product, but as others have stated these are replicas and you get what you pay for. I've owned the TRD louvers for coming up on 2 years. They sit out in the Florida sun every day baking to over 120 degrees and still don't flex as much as these do in the video. I would be scared they would crack and need replacing in my climate.
